In national context, BN3 7QD is one of the most affluent neighbourhoods in England — IMD decile 9/10, ranked 27,852 of 32,844 neighbourhoods in England. The Index of Multiple Deprivation is the UK government's official measure of relative deprivation, refreshed roughly every five years. Housing pressure here is low (IMD housing decile 8/10).

The location is in Flood Zone 1 (low risk — less than a 1 in 1,000 annual chance of river or sea flooding). road traffic noise is low (about 52 dB Lden).
